What We Check
- Thermostat call, power, and control sequence
- Airflow restrictions, filter condition, and duct symptoms
- Electrical readings, safety switches, and visible wear
- Repair practicality based on age, parts, and repeat failures
Cost Factors
- System accessibility and time needed for diagnosis
- Brand, model, and part availability
- Emergency timing versus scheduled service
- Whether a repair solves the root cause or only the symptom
